Las Palmas

Las Palmas offers a vibrant atmosphere with its bustling streets and beautiful beaches. It’s known for its rich history and diverse culture, attracting visitors from all over the world. Tourists can explore the charming old town of Vegueta, where cobblestone streets and historic buildings abound. The local cuisine showcases delicious Canarian dishes that visitors can’t resist trying. Las Canteras Beach is a popular spot, perfect for sunbathing and water sports. There’s also a lively nightlife scene, with bars and clubs catering to all tastes. The city hosts various festivals throughout the year, showcasing its vibrant traditions. For shopping enthusiasts, the commercial areas offer a mix of local boutiques and international brands. In Las Palmas, visitors can enjoy a unique blend of relaxation and excitement.

Puerto Rico

Puerto Rico offers a vibrant atmosphere with plenty of activities and beautiful beaches for visitors to enjoy. It’s known for its lively nightlife, attracting tourists looking for entertainment after sunset. The area boasts stunning beaches like Amadores and Playa de Puerto Rico, perfect for sunbathing and water sports. Visitors can explore the nearby marina, where they can find a variety of restaurants and shops. Families often appreciate the kid-friendly activities available, including water parks and play areas. It’s also a great spot for those seeking relaxation, with numerous spa services offered in local hotels. The picturesque views from the cliffs provide an ideal backdrop for memorable photographs. With its pleasant climate year-round, Puerto Rico remains a popular destination. It’s no wonder that many travelers consider it one of the best areas to stay in Gran Canaria.

What local cuisine should i try while staying in gran canaria?

When in Gran Canaria, one should definitely try the local dish called "papas arrugadas," which are wrinkled potatoes served with a spicy mojo sauce. They’ll also love the fresh seafood, particularly the grilled fish, which reflects the island’s culinary traditions.
